Output c94364244c506734a3d3505c4f434a393a3d1de1af82d422f1f0dd4b4d2ac4e4:0

value
631158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4199cf7dfa91006d0982c32fff955aa31aed51e OP_EQUAL
address
3PwhUz1ZMpntdf5sJAQuGMAVibtXFU5qPk
transaction
c94364244c506734a3d3505c4f434a393a3d1de1af82d422f1f0dd4b4d2ac4e4
confirmations
157333
spent
true